Detention Center

Photo of the Johnston County Detention Center

The Johnston County Detention Center (Jail) is located at the courthouse and is designed to house 190 inmates.  The Detention Center is a division of the Sheriff's Office, and is managed by an Administrator who oversees the daily roles of the additional 55 employees.  There are also two nurses from the Health Department assigned to the Detention Center that address the medical needs of the inmates. 

The Detention Center operates 24 hours a day, 7 days a week.  During the year 2003 we had an average daily population of 200 county and federal inmates.  The kitchen staff are currently serving over 600 meals per day. 

The primary purpose of the Detention Center is to provide a secure confinement facility for the housing of inmates who are in "pending trial'' status and those inmates serving short term misdemeanor sentences.  The Detention Center provides a humane, safe, and healthy environment for staff and inmates.  Other duties include transporting inmates to and from prison units, and for court appearances, maintaining proper computerized records on inmates, security of inmates' personal property and inmate medical needs.
